首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

尝试创建表达式以根据日期对事件进行计数

创建表达式以根据日期对事件进行计数的方法有多种。以下是其中一种常用的实现方式:

  1. 首先,确定要统计的日期范围,比如过去的一周、一个月或一年。
  2. 然后,选择一个合适的编程语言和相应的日期处理库。常见的编程语言如Python、Java、JavaScript都有相关的日期处理库,例如Python的datetime模块、Java的java.time包、JavaScript的Date对象。
  3. 使用选择的编程语言和日期处理库,编写代码以获取当前日期,并将其与事件发生的日期进行比较。
  4. 对于每个事件,检查它的日期是否在所选日期范围内。如果是,则将计数器加1。

以下是一个使用Python编写的示例代码:

代码语言:txt
复制
from datetime import datetime, timedelta

# 统计过去一周的事件计数
start_date = datetime.now() - timedelta(days=7)
end_date = datetime.now()

event_count = 0

# 假设events是包含事件日期的列表
events = [event1_date, event2_date, ...]

for event_date in events:
    if start_date <= event_date <= end_date:
        event_count += 1

print("过去一周的事件计数:", event_count)

在这个示例中,我们使用了Python的datetime模块来处理日期和时间。通过计算当前日期与过去一周的日期范围,我们可以遍历事件列表并逐个比较日期。如果事件的日期在所选日期范围内,计数器就会增加。

对于实际应用场景,这个表达式可以用于各种需要对事件进行统计和分析的情况,例如网站访问量统计、用户活动统计、产品销售统计等。

推荐的腾讯云相关产品:腾讯云函数(云原生Serverless计算服务),该服务可以帮助您在无需管理服务器的情况下运行代码,并提供与其他腾讯云产品的无缝集成。您可以使用腾讯云函数来自动执行上述计数逻辑,并将结果存储到腾讯云数据库或对象存储中。

腾讯云函数介绍链接地址:腾讯云函数

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券